    Abstract

    This work presents a fast object-tracking algorithm using the lifting wavelet filters. The algorithm solves a linear system of simultaneous equations of free parameters in the lifting filter and searches a small region for objects. In simulation, it is shown that the algorithm can track the object in a sequence of images.
